October 27 1932 February 11 1963 was an American poet novelist and short-story writerShe is credited with advancing the genre of confessional poetry and is best known for two of her published collections The Colossus and Other Poems and Ariel as well as The Bell Jar a semi-autobiographical novel published shortly before her death.
